What is a battery energy storage system?
A battery energy storage system (BESS), battery storage power station, battery energy grid storage (BEGS) or battery grid storage is a type of energy storage technology that uses a group of batteries in the grid to store electrical energy.
How much does a 4 hour battery system cost?
Figure ES-2 shows the overall capital cost for a 4-hour battery system based on those projections, with storage costs of $245/kWh, $326/kWh, and $403/kWh in 2030 and $159/kWh, $226/kWh, and $348/kWh in 2050.
How much electricity can you store in Bath County?
For example, the Bath County Pumped Storage Station, the second largest in the world, can store 24 GWh of electricity and dispatch 3 GW while the first phase of Vistra Energy 's Moss Landing Energy Storage Facility can store 1.2 GWh and dispatch 300 MW.
How long do battery energy storage systems last?
Battery energy storage systems are generally designed to deliver their full rated power for durations ranging from 1 to 4 hours, with emerging technologies extending this to longer durations to meet evolving grid demands.

What are the components of the automatic battery swapping station?
The main components of the automatic battery swapping station. underground. The cyclic battery pack storage device has two sets and is located on both sides of the swapping platf orm. The cyclic battery pack storage device can change the battery packs from the battery swapping pos ition back to the storage position.
How does a battery swapping system work?
During the battery swapping process, there is no need to lift the vehicle, which saves the high-power motor that woul d be necessary to do so. The design also controls the overall height of the swapping platform and station. The battery pack can be easily lifted and stacked without the need for complex lifting mechanisms.
Is battery swapping a promising technology?
Abstract. Battery swapping is a promising technology when compared with the traditional electric vehicle charging stations. The time spent at a battery swapping station might be similar to the time spent at a filling station.
